NANS Senators Threaten Boycott Over March 25 Convention Date

 

 

By, Olawale Ogunbusola

 

Senators of the National Association of Nigerian Students (NANS), Joint Campus Council (JCC) Oyo State Chapter have threatened to boycott the forthcoming convention if the date is not changed to accommodate their academic schedules.

In a petition to the Convention Planning Committee (CPC) on Monday, the NANS Senators expressed dissatisfaction with 25th March, 2026 as scheduled date, citing ongoing examinations in their institutions.

The association demanded a new date as to allow its full participation, warning that proceeding without the entire body will undermine the convention’s legitimacy.

“It is both alarming and unacceptable that a date of such importance was fixed, that is 25th March, 2026 without due consideration for the academic engagements of the majority of Senators. As it stands, over two-thirds (2/3) of Senators are currently involved in ongoing examinations within their respective institutions, making attendance practically impossible.”, it said.

The NANS Senate ultimatum comes amid concerns over marginalization and lack of access to convention grounds, as highlighted by NANS JCC chairmen in a recent protest.

The chairmen of National Association of Nigerian Students, NANS, have called for inclusive policies and recognition of their roles in representing grassroots student interests.

Meanwhile, the Student Union has urged the Oyo State government to intervene, as Governor Seyi Makinde has previously been demonstrating support for student welfare initiatives.

However, the outcome of this standoff remains uncertain, with Union Senate prepared to take further action if their demands are not met.

” We therefore strongly demand the immediate postponement and rescheduling of the convention to a date that accommodates the academic realities of Senators.

“Failure to heed this demand will leave us with no option but to formally dissociate ourselves from the outcomes of such a convention and take further necessary actions in defence of democratic principles.”, the statement stated.

Recall, the petition has been copied to relevant authorities, including the Executive Governor of Oyo State, NANS National President, DSS, among others.
